Black Hole Merger Provides Clearest Evidence Yet that Einstein, Hawking, and Kerr were Right

Black Hole Merger Provides Clearest Evidence Yet that Einstein, Hawking, and Kerr were Right

In February 2016, scientists at the Laser Interferometer Gravitational wave Observatory (LIGO) announced the first detection of gravitational waves (GW). These ripples in space time, originally predicted by Einstein’s Theory of General Relativity, are caused by the merger of massive objects (like neutron stars and black holes). First black hole ever imaged has changed ‘dramatically’ in just 4 years, new study finds

First black hole ever imaged has changed ‘dramatically’ in just 4 years, new study finds

One of the first black holes ever imaged is even stranger than we thought, new images of its dramatically changing environment reveal. The object, known as M87*, has experienced unexpected changes in its magnetic fields that are showing up in polarized light — meaning, light waves that are orientated in the same way (such as vertically, or horizontally).
